Growing up in Egypt, I knew access to news could be fragile. I didn’t expect to lose it again in Canada

iStock / Ana Luisa O. J. W hen I moved to Canada in 2024, I was shocked to discover that I couldn’t access news pages on Facebook and Instagram. As an Egyptian journalist used to government censorship and blocked websites, I relied heavily on social media for timely news. I still visit a list of news websites daily, but the Meta-owned platforms are crucial for accessing exclusive visual content-like photo series, short videos, and multimedia reports.
